You are invited to a collective ideation session around the guiding questions: What does the word "work" mean to us and how might we possibly reframe it to better support us? What does your "dream job" look like? What kind of future do you wish to create? Who do you share this vision with?
We will dream about what sustainable, non-hierarchical, creative, empowering work might look like and feel like, both for you as an individual and where our individual dreams might overlap or support each other's. What do you have to offer such a group, and what do you seek?
At the least it is a useful thought experiment. At the most it is a seed to grow a group that could end up working together in some capacity towards common goals.
